Mango Salsa

This mango salsa is our go-to recipe for juicy mangoes of the season! A salsa recipe that is full of flavor, goes great with so many dishes, and is super easy to make. Wonderful to serve with grilled tofu, fish, chicken and even beef. Just delightful on its own with your favorite tortilla dish. Recipe yields about 3 cups.

Ingredients

  • 2 plum tomatoes diced
  • 2 cups mangoes diced
  • 3 scallions diced
  • ½ cup red onion chopped
  • juice of two limes
  • ¼ cup cilantro chopped (just the leaves)
  • 2 Tablespoons olive oil

Instructions

  • Mix all the ingredients in a small bowl. Check the flavor and adjust, if needed, by adding more lime juice, extra-virgin olive oil and even salt. Serve immediately with tacos or just some good chips.

Notes

STORAGE SUGGESTIONS: To be totally honest, if you have any leftovers, it will be a surprise! Especially if you serve it for friends or family. If you do have any leftovers, tore it in an airtight container in the refrigerator for a few days. It's best served fresh.
